Reporting into the Ecommerce Manager, this role involves supporting ecommerce operations across all websites and channels within the group. You will be primarily focussed on building relationships with key stakeholders to arrange campaigns to grow sales
. You will be part of a team of 9 dedicated to Ecommerce and also be a part of the Marketing team. Whats in your remit? Co-ordination of email marketing, SMS and push notification plans across D2C / D2B (approx. 12 email campaigns per week across brands / shops). Use of Google Analytics, 3rd party systems, and internal BI reports in order to identify products / stock in order to effectively plan campaigns. Communication with Ecommerce, Marketing, Customer Services, Operations, IT / Web Development, Sales and Retail Managers. Briefing of creative artwork, including build, segmentation, testing and deployment. Responsibility for monthly reports, managing IP reputation and deliverability rates. Devise and execute continual A/B testing of email layouts, frequency, send time optimisation and subject lines using statistical relevance. Plan, develop and implement automated / triggered email programs. Regularly monitor email KPIs (including net subscriber growth) IP reputation, deliverability rates and budget, producing monthly reports. Responsible for online sign-up mechanics across channels, scoping recommendations for improvement on subscriber rates. What will you bring to the role? Excellent HTML / CSS skills with knowledge of responsive frameworks. Excellent written communications and copywriting skills. A quick learner with excellent attention to detail and a commercial mindset. Good troubleshooting skills. Digital creative skills would be advantageous. Good understanding of Google Analytics (utm tracking). Good understanding of email KPIs and e-marketing best practices. Good numerical and Excel skills. Knowledge of Magento 2, Ometira, Salesforce Marketing Cloud and MailChimp beneficial.
